Proc sql in sas tutorial torrent

A base sas procedure combines data and proc step capabilities similar to ansi standard sql syntax can read sas data files, views, data bases with sas. Group by, summary functions joining merge w by inner and outer joins conditional processing ifthen statements casewhen. Advanced subqueries in proc sql this paper was written by systems seminar consultants, inc. I used this code 1 worked fine, code 2 brought zero rows, so not sure what happened, is there any better way to write it. Is there a way to avoid the warning for the following code. Introduction a proc sql view is a stored query that is executed when you use the view in a sas procedure, data step, or function. Before we start the training, you will need to have at least one of the following programs installed. It includes both basics and advanced tutorials related to proc sql. An introduction to proc sql sas support ulibraries. Only a very thorough manual, such as the sas guide to the.

A guide to mastering sas 2nd edition provides an introduction to sas statistical software, the premiere statistical data analysis tool for scientific research. Through its straightforward approach, the text presents sas with stepbystep examples. The out option is a valid form of the outlib option. You should include these three options when using proc export. Introduction to sas free tutorials for learning sas, sql. Creating buckets in analytical datasets using proc sql. Proc sql can sort, summarize, subset, join merge, and concatenate datasets, create new variables, and print the results. For more information, see cv2view procedure in sas access for relational databases.

Proc sql by example using sql within sas downloads torrent. Do you need to make sql server data available for a sas analytics package. Search for strings with apostrophes in sas proc sql. Using proc append to join similar data sets in sas programming using proc append to join similar data sets in sas programming courses with reference manuals and examples pdf. A view contains only the descriptor and other information required to retrieve the data values from other sas files sas data files, data step views, or other proc sql views or external files dbms data files. Im not so much interested in a system option to turn off warnings, rather, i am curious as to whether or. This course can help prepare you for the following certification exam s. In this sas sql tutorial, we will show you 5 different ways to manipulate and analyze your data using the sas sql procedure and proc sql sas. Do you also need to accept some data back from a sas package and also process the returned values. Sas tutorial for beginners getting started with sas. These tutorials include introduction of sql with examples, proc sql joins, conditional statements and useful tips and tricks of sql etc.

Proc sql tips and techniques sas proceedings and more. Just a little curious about this one, is there any limitations of where statement. Proc sql sets the column width at n and specifies that character columns longer than n are flowed to multiple lines. Tips and translations for data step users susan p marcella, exxonmobil biomedical sciences, inc. This course is the first part of the sas certified specialist exam training program. A quick and easy guide to the proc sql procedure in sas enterprise guide. The select statement that is shown in this example performs summation, grouping, sorting, and row selection. In this tip we cover how a sql server professional with limited or no sas experie. Starting in sas 9, proc sql views, the passthrough facility, and the sas access libname statement are the preferred ways to access relational dbms data. In addition to using classic sas code to read and process sql server data with a libname statement, you can also use proc sql statements. Sas is a powerful and versatile language for data manipulation, and the ability to implement sql within sas creates additional levels of usefulness and flexibility. It is mostly used to format the output data of a sas program to nice reports which are good to look at and understand. Get your hands dirty with our practical coding projects and learn how to read in, clean up, manipulate, analyze and.

When you specify flown m, proc sql floats the width of the columns between these limits to achieve a balanced layout. Proc export is a procedure that allows you to export a sas data set to an external file such as an excel spreadsheet or a text file. Using sas access and proc sql to retrieve sql server data. Basics of sas proc sql1 free download as powerpoint presentation. How to start sascrunch training interactive sas training. This tutorial is designed for beginners who want to get started with proc sql. If you want to create a permanent sas data set, you must define the libref before specifying the proc download statement, and you must specify a twolevel sas data set name. Capability data step proc sql creating sas data sets sas data files or sas views x x create indexes on tables x creating sas data sets from input files that contain raw data external files x analyzing, manipulating, or presenting your data x x listing reports. The select statement is the primary tool of proc sql. The output from a sas program can be converted to more user friendly forms like.

This is done by using the ods statement available in sas. A typically sas program consists of one or more data steps to get and define the data as a required format that sas can understand and one or more proc steps to analyze the data. This example shows that proc sql can achieve the same results as base sas software but often with fewer and shorter statements. In simple words, sas can process complex data and generate meaningful insights that would help organizations take better decisions or predict possible outcomes in the near future. Sas programming online tutorial proc sql 02 youtube. Complete sas tutorial for beginners sascrunch training. Sql tutorial for beginners sql full courselearn proc sql. Dictionary have been moved to this book, sas sql procedure users guide. You view a data table, write and submit sas code, view the log and results, and use interactive features to quickly generate graphs and statistical analyses.

Also, it will attempt to compare the techniques of data step and proc sql. Sas studio university edition or sas base program sas studio is totally free. The difference between sas and sql terminology is shown in the table below. Use features like bookmarks, note taking and highlighting while reading proc sql. Welcome to sascrunch practical sas training course for beginners. Flow noflow specifies that character columns longer than n are flowed to multiple lines. Proc sql was the very first book that i promoted when joining sas. The inclusion of proc sql in the sas package made a very powerful addition to the sas programmers repertoire of.

Sql tutorial for beginners sql full course learn proc sql structured query language step by step advanced sas programming tutorial video helps you to learn complete proc sql programming with. Proc sql, which is the sas implementation of structured query language, has provided another extremely versatile tool in the base sas arsenal for data manipulation. Using the select statement, you can identify, manipulate, and retrieve columns of data from one or more tables and views. Sas offers extensive support to most of the popular relational databases by using sql queries inside sas programs.

Still, for many of us who began using sas prior to the addition of sql or learned from hardcore data step programmers, change may not come easily. Reading and processing sql server data with proc sql. In this video, you get started with programming in sas studio. The following is a step by step guide of proc sql which would help you to learn sql from scratch and how to run it in sas. It includes both basics and advanced tutorials related to. Proc sql tutorial for beginners 20 examples proc sql joins merging combining tables vertically with proc sql. A beginner level sas user should at least know how to create the simple data sets and performing minimum operations to. Learning by doing is the best way to master a programming language. Selects columns and rows of data from tables and views.

This tutorial is designed keeping in mind users would have no background of programming or sql. Using proc append to join similar data sets in sas. The most basic usage of proc sql is to display or print all variables columns and observations rows from a given dataset in the sas results window. Class dataset with base sas code, you can see here how to print the entire dataset to the results window using the print procedure. Beyond the basics using sas, second edition kindle edition by lafler, kirk paul. This enables our customers to access proc sql information in one location. Download it once and read it on your kindle device, pc, phones or tablets.

And his book continues to appeal to userswhether theyre online or at conferences. One of the easiest ways to get your foot inside the door of the analytics industry is to get yourself sas certified. Proc sql a primer for sas programmers jimmy defoor citi card irving, texas the structured query language sql has a very different syntax and, often, a very different method of creating the desired results than the sas data step and the sas procedures. Beyond the basics using sas are the source of this weeks tip. Outfile option the outfile option lets you specify the exporting file. Proc sql is an advanced sas procedure that helps to run sql queries to manage and manipulate data. You can convert existing sas access views to proc sql views by using the cv2view procedure. Moreover, we will see the comparisons on how to accomplish the same task with base sas code are also made throughout the article with some sas sql example. You should already know how to create basic proc sql queries by using the select statement and most of its subordinate clauses. Using sql within sas, author howard schreier illustrates the use of proc sql in the context of the sas data step and other sas procedures such as sort, freq, means, summary, append, datasets, and transpose whose functionality overlaps and complements that of sql. This course teaches you how to process sas data using structured query language sql. Creating buckets with proc sql systems seminar consultants, inc. Kirk was the perfect first sas press author to work with and he remains a favorite. Not only does proc sql often use fewer and shorter statements than builtin sas procedures, it also often improves the efficiency of the code.